Best Auto Sketch Could Earn High Schooler A Chance To Become A Car Designer


For the past several months Dodge has left no doubt that it’s a brand focused on performance. Exhibit A: The 707-horsepower SRT Hellcat versions of the redesigned Dodge Challenger and Charger.
But what will Dodge look like 10 years from now, in 2025? The best answer to that question earns a U.S. high school sophomore, junior or senior a $60,000 scholarship to one of the top design schools in the country, the College for Creative Studies in Detroit, popularly known as CCS. The challenge: Design a 2025 Dodge vehicle – it’s your choice if that’s a sports car, sedan, SUV, crossover or whatever.
